+This directory contains code uses to measure the performance of the Vanadium RPC stack.
+
+---
+
+This benchmarks use Go's testing package to run benchmarks. Each benchmark involves
+one server and one client. The server has two very simple methods that echo the data
+received from the client back to the client.
+
+* `client ---- Echo(payload) ----> server`
+* `client <--- return payload ---- server`
+
+There are two versions of the Echo method:
+
+* `Echo(payload []byte) ([]byte], error)`
+* `EchoStream() <[]byte,[]byte> error`
+
+# Microbenchmarks
+## `benchmark_test.go`
+
+The first benchmarks use the non-streaming version of Echo with a varying
+payload size. The second benchmarks use the streaming version with varying
+number of chunks and payload sizes. The third one is for measuring the
+performance with multiple clients hosted in the same process.
+
+This test creates a VC before the benchmark begins. So, the VC creation
+overhead is excluded.
+

+# Client/Server
+## `{benchmark,benchmarkd}/main.go`
+
+benchmarkd/main.go and benchmark/main.go are simple command-line tools to run the
+benchmark server and client as separate processes. Unlike the benchmarks above,
+this test includes the startup cost of name resolution, creating the VC, etc. in
+the first RPC.
+

+# Raspberry Pi
+
+On a Raspberry Pi, everything is much slower. The same tests show the following
+results:
+
+```
+$ ./main
+RPC Connection 1765.47 ms/rpc
+RPC (echo 1000B) 78.61 ms/rpc (12.72 qps)
+RPC Streaming (echo 1000B) 23.85 ms/rpc
+RPC Streaming Throughput (echo 1MB) 0.92 MB/s
+```
+
+On a Raspberry Pi 2,
+
+```
+$ ./main
+RPC Connection 847.41 ms/rpc
+RPC (echo 1000B) 16.47 ms/rpc (60.71 qps)
+RPC Streaming (echo 1000B) 3.33 ms/rpc
+RPC Streaming Throughput (echo 1MB) 2.31 MB/s
+```
